The Evolution CTS is an in-cab controller, monitor, and digital gauge display for your gas powered truck. This power programmer maximizes performance in a variety of ways. Simply plug in to the OBDII (diagnostic) port under the dash and select one of the performance program levels to re-program your truck's computer. With a 4.3 inch full color touch screen monitoring your vital engine information is easy and clear. The Evolution CTS is back-up camera ready and can engage camera when vehicle is put in reverse.

Mazda CX-7 gets sporty makeover for Europe

Fri, 29 Sep 2006

By Ben Whitworth Motor Industry 29 September 2006 03:13 Mazda is scrabbling to ready a muscular 170bhp turbodiesel engine for its new CX-7 crossover, which arrives in Europe next summer. Although the five-seat 4x4 will initially come with a 258bhp version of the Mazda 6 MPS's turbocharged 2.3-litre four, European market demands for diesel power mean Mazda will unleash a new 2.2-litre version of its four-cylinder diesel. This engine will be hooked up to a slick six-speed manual or five-gear automatic transmission.

Mini Coupe

Tue, 21 Jun 2011

Mini's ever expanding line-up is set to grow yet again with this latest addition: the Coupe. Retaining most of the details first seen in the original 2009 concept, the strict two-seater features a distinctive 'helmet roof'. The new Coupe is an 'expression of the distinctive Mini design', according to the company, but it's also a departure from the brand's current offerings.
